Observation of clinical treatment for palatal fractures

Jun-wen WANG1,(), Guo-guang PENG1, Xin YAN1, Mei-xing REN1   

  1. 1.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ery, No.4 People's Hospital of Huizhou, Huizhou 516055, China
  • Received:2013-04-03 Online:2013-10-01 Published:2025-03-15
  • Contact: Jun-wen WANG

Abstract:

Objective

To discuss the clinical classification and treatment of palatal fractures.

Methods

Based on the review and analysis of 94 cases of palatal fractures, palatal fractures were classified into three types according to clinical manifestation and relevant literatures. And the treatment of each type of palatal fractures was discussed. Among the cases observed, 41 cases received conservative treatment, and 53 cases received surgical operation and rigid internal fixation.

Results

All of the incisions were primarily healed. The occlusion was normal, without complications such as implant reveal and stillicidium narium.

Conclusion

Different types of palatal fractures could be replaced in different ways, reliably restoring the facial shape and occlusion of the patients.

Key words: Maxillary fractures, Palatal Fracture, Classification, Treatment
